What Is Asphalt Flooring?

Asphalt flooring is a waterproofing membrane. It is carbon zero rated, durable, and dust free. It is also easy to maintain with asphalt repairs being very straightforward.

The installation time of asphalt flooring is very fast with minimal disruption. It can be installed using a hot charge process meaning the floor cools off very quickly. This allows furnishing and carpets to be put back in a short period of time.

Mastic asphalt can be seen used for flooring both domestically and commercially. Domestically it is seen in a lot of houses in the UK. And commercially it is often used in school classrooms and warehousing. By choosing mastic asphalt flooring you have a solution which is both an effective waterproofing membrane1 and gas radon barrier2.
